Output 158f67e63ceb97def4ea867d8b89ada96f46e9a40b023d594f19ab2b27374a86:0

value
3821268
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cc37126652b67bda7c8979b9b8c45e30d41c515a OP_EQUALVERIFY OP_CHECKSIG
address
1KcnpbUASYCDq5pWohf1ftJrSQNhsf8P29
transaction
158f67e63ceb97def4ea867d8b89ada96f46e9a40b023d594f19ab2b27374a86
spent
true